The quote "Today is the tomorrow you worried about yesterday" is attributed to Dale Carnegie, a renowned self-help author and motivational speaker. There is no specific date associated with when he said it, as it is a commonly shared sentiment in the realm of personal development and inspirational quotes.

If a teacher walked into the classroom and said "If only yesterday was tomorrow, today would have been Saturday" then the day would have to be Monday. The day before Monday is Sunday, and if Sunday were the next day, the current day would be Saturday.
